Taking third place this month (narrowly beating out Duskfade and Future Knight), Kynseed launched in early August.
Made by Pixelcount, a team of former Fable devs who have been working on this for years on PC, this console release for the indie life-sim had some issues, but it did enough for the team to come away feeling plenty positive.
"It may not be the fairest of them all, but it’s a merry time nonetheless," said Michelle in her review. Absolutely worth investigating.
